Historic Preservation Commission Small Grant Funding Program
Solicitation # FY27-HPC-01
The City of Cottonwood is soliciting applications for the Fiscal Year 2027 Historic Preservation Commission Small Grant Funding Program under solicitation FY27-HPC-01. This program provides financial assistance to property owners for the rehabilitation, preservation, and restoration of the exterior portions of historic buildings, structures, or sites. To be eligible, properties must be located within the Old Town Special Planning Area, listed on the National Register of Historic Places, or designated as local historic landmarks. The maximum grant award is 3,500 dollars per project, which requires a 50 percent matching cash contribution from the recipient. Applications must be submitted by November 30, 2026, at 10:00 a.m. local Arizona time via the City's eProcurement portal and through a physical sealed envelope delivered to the Purchasing Division. Proposals are evaluated on a points-based system with a maximum of 80 points, placing the highest emphasis on the scope of work, which must include detailed narrative descriptions, construction plan drawings, and material lists. Funding is disbursed on a reimbursement basis following the completion of work, a successful inspection by City staff, and the submission of paid invoices. Awardees must also obtain an approved Certificate of Appropriateness before starting any work and ensure all activities comply with City Code requirements.

Castle Air Museum Aviation Pavilion Project (RSO 0272-25, SP 25-10-0200, AR 25-10-0300)
Solicitation # RSO 0272-25, SP 25-10-0200, AR 25-10-0300
The Castle Air Museum Aviation Pavilion Project, managed by the City of Atwater, involves the multi-phased development of a 31.14-acre parcel located at 5050 Santa Fe Drive, Atwater, California. The project consists of new construction, site improvements, and the relocation of a pre-engineered metal building from Beale Air Force Base. Development is divided into three phases: Phase 1 includes a 60,000 square foot pavilion, a 28,000 square foot roof covered area, and the relocation of a 9,600 square foot SR-71 hangar. Phase 2 features a 50,000 square foot pavilion, a 10,000 square foot cafe and gift shop, a 30,000 square foot roof covered area, and a parking lot with 177 stalls. Phase 3 consists of an 80,000 square foot pavilion. The project has undergone environmental review under the California Environmental Quality Act, resulting in a Mitigated Negative Declaration approved on November 19, 2025. Compliance requirements include adherence to the 2022 California Green Building Standards Code for indoor and outdoor water use, the Model Water Efficient Landscape Ordinance, and the California Plumbing Code regarding submetering for buildings exceeding 50,000 square feet. The Department of Toxic Substances Control has provided specific guidance to protect groundwater monitoring and extraction systems on the site. Project approval is tied to Resolution RSO 0272-25, Site Plan Review SP 25-10-0200, and Architectural Review AR 25-10-0300, with final verification occurring through the standard building permit and inspection process.

26-422DNR-LNDMG-B-49970 | SMALL PURCHASE WITH SOLE SOURCE CONDITIONS Cahokia Mounds SHS Mound 72 Exhibit Modifications
Solicitation # 26-422DNR-LNDMG-B-49970
Solicitation 26-422DNR-LNDMG-B-49970 is a small purchase with sole source conditions awarded to Taylor Studios for exhibit modifications at the Cahokia Mounds State Historic Site in Collinsville, Illinois. The project, valued at 22,000 dollars, involves exhibit and graphic design, fabrication, and installation. The scope of work includes removing a life-sized mannequin from a gallery acrylic case and replacing it with a model of the Mound 72 landscape, featuring multiple mounds, a raised walkway, and a lighted component illustrating the solstice sunrise and sunset positions. Additionally, the vendor will modify labels depicting burial items and activities and replace the didactic label on the front of the exhibit, while reusing existing cases and walls. The contract is governed by the Illinois State Standard Terms and Conditions V23.2, requiring compliance with the Illinois Procurement Code and the State Prompt Payment Act. Taylor Studios must maintain specific insurance coverages, including 1,000,000 dollars per occurrence for general commercial liability and auto liability, and provide worker's compensation as required by law. All work is considered work for hire, granting the State of Illinois exclusive ownership of the intellectual property. The agreement emphasizes that time is of the essence and is contingent upon the availability of funds, which may include partial or total federal funding.
